After flying high against Lakeview on Thursday, Seward came back down to earth. The Bluejays lost 4-0 to the Northwest Vikings on Monday. The defeat continues a trend for Seward in their meetings with Northwest: they've now lost six in a row.
Seward's loss dropped their record down to 7-5. As for Northwest,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 9-2.
We've got plenty of inter-district action coming up soon. Seward will square off against rival Aurora on Tuesday. Meanwhile, Northwest is set to face off against their familiar foe Lexington at 6:00 p.m. on Monday.
